About this school

Maylandsea Primary School is a primary academy in Chelmsford. It teaches children aged 5 to 11 and has 217 pupils on roll.

You can read Ofsted's latest judgement for the school below. Where the Department for Education has published them, its results and pupil characteristics appear below. Seeing a school for yourself shows what no page can, so arrange a visit before you apply.

Ofsted judgement

England: previous inspection framework
Inspected 20 June 2024 · short inspection
Good

Confirmed by a short inspection, not a full one

Ofsted's most recent visit was a short inspection on 20 June 2024, where inspectors confirmed the school remains Good. The school's last full inspection took place before September 2019, so its area grades are not part of Ofsted's current published data. Older reports are on the school's Ofsted page.

Exam results

Key stage 2 (end of primary school)

Measure 2022/23 2023/24 2024/25
Pupils at the end of key stage 2 39 41 46
Met the expected standard in reading, writing and maths 54% 59% 63%
Reached the higher standard in reading, writing and maths 5% 2% 9%
Expected standard in reading 77% 71% 80%
Expected standard in maths 72% 68% 76%
Expected standard in grammar, punctuation and spelling 72% 71% 74%
Average scaled score in reading 104.0 104.0 106.0
Average scaled score in maths 103.0 102.0 104.0
Reading progress -2.50 - -
Writing progress -1.60 - -
Maths progress -2.00 - -

Progress measures ended nationally after the 2022/23 school year, when the key stage 1 assessments they were based on were stopped. Blank progress figures in later years are not missing school data.

How Maylandsea Primary School compares

Maylandsea Primary School ranked 219th of 388 primary schools in Essex for KS2 results in 2024/25. Its KS2 result was higher than 47% of England primary schools that published results in 2024/25. Its absence rate was lower than 36% of England schools in 2024/25.

School KS2 RWM (2024/25) Absence FSM (6 years) Pupils Distance
This school 63% 6.2% 14.4% 217
Christchurch Church of England Primary School 33% 6.9% 30.3% 109 1.7 miles
St Leonard's Church of England Primary School 29% 9.1% 30% 258 3.4 miles
Cold Norton Primary School 70% 5% 7.6% 157 4.0 miles
St Mary's Church of England Voluntary Aided Primary School, Burnham-on-Crouch 94% 4.6% 15.8% 246 4.0 miles
Purleigh Community Primary School 74% 3.9% 11.2% 206 4.4 miles

Results reflect each school's cohort as much as its teaching, and free school meals share is context, not a judgement. Small gaps between neighbouring schools are rarely meaningful on their own.
